The phrase "again unresolved"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to indicate that a situation or issue remains unresolved after having been addressed previously.
Example: "Despite our efforts to discuss the matter, it remains again unresolved, leaving us with no clear path forward."
Alternatives: "still unresolved" or "once more unresolved".
